List of equestrian statues in Poland
This is a list of equestrian statues in Poland.
Warsaw[]
- Equestrian Statue of King Jan III Sobieski in the Wilanów Palace park.
- Equestrian Statue of Prince Józef Antoni Poniatowski in front of the Presidential Palace by Bertel Thorvaldsen.
- Monument to The Polish Cavalry.
- Monument to The Polish Hussars.
Bydgoszcz[]
- Equestrian of King Kazimierz Wielki.

Gdańsk[]
- John III Sobieski Monument in Gdańsk by Tadeusz Barącz.
- Equestrian of Emperor Wilhelm I in front of the Brama Wyżynna (High gate), destroyed.
Jelenia Góra[]
- Equestrian of Don Quixote and Sancho Panza by Vahan Bego
Katowice[]
- Equestrian of Field Marshal Piłsudski by Antun Augustinčić.
Komarów-Osada[]
- Monument to The Polish Cavalry.
Monument to The Polish Cavalry, Komarów-Osada
Kraków[]
- Equestrian of General Tadeusz Kościuszko by Leonard Marconi and Antoni Popiel.
- Battle of Grunwald Monument (Monument to King Władysław Jagiełło) by Antoni Wiwulski, 1914.
Battle of Grunwald monument, Kraków
Lublin[]
- Equestrian of Field Marshal Piłsudski by Jan Raszka.
Marcinkowo Górne[]
- Equestrian of Prince Leszek Biały by , 1927.
Prince Leszek Biały, Marcinkowo Górne
Odolanów[]
- Monument to Saint Martin of Tours by .
Saint Martin of Tours, Odolanów
Opole[]
- Monument to Postal Workers killed in action in World War I by .
Monument to Postal Workers, Opole
Ostrów Mazowiecka[]
- Equestrian of Field Marshal Józef Piłsudski by .
Poznań[]
- Monument to 15th Poznań Uhlans regiment.
Szczecin[]
- Equestrian of Bartolomeo Colleoni, the replica of the statue in Venice.
- Monument to Emperor Wilhelm I, destroyed.
Emperor Wilhelm I, Szczecin
Wrocław[]
- Equestrian of King Bolesław Chrobry, 2007.
Zamość[]
- Equestrian of Hetman Jan Zamoyski by Marian Konieczny.
